22 US Commandos Injured in Syria Helicopter Mishap

The 22 soldiers injured in a helicopter accident in northeastern Syria on Sunday were part of the Army’s highly secretive Delta Force commando unit, which has previously carried out kill-or-capture raids against Islamic State militants in that part of the country. The soldiers were flown to Germany for medical treatment, but none of their injuries were life-threatening. The cause of the accident is still under investigation.
